Political Ephemera Relating to National Service Act and Parliament
Author:
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 0
Book Description
Predominantly consists of news clippings relating to the National Service Act including prosecution of draft resisters, comments from Parliamentarians and debate surrounding the Act in Parliament. Includes questions put forward by Tony Dalton and Michael Hamel-Green for Questions on Notice to be asked by Gordon Bryant and J.L. Cavanagh, Department of Labour and National Service statistics from across Australia relating to failure to register for National Service, a letter from Gough Whitlam to Tony Dalton in response to the policy statement of the Draft Resisters' Union, statistics of prosecutions for failure to register and failure to attend medical examination, a statement undersigned by a list of draft resisters addressing selective prosecutions under the National Service Act, refusal to comply with the Act and a declaration of opposition to Australian and US involvement in Vietnam, an excerpt from Hansard on 20 April, 1939 where Robert Menzies addresses the attack brought against him by caretaker Prime Minister Earle Page regarding his decision not to serve during WW1. This excerpt is referred to by Jim Cairns and Tom Uren in the Hansard for 17 November, 1964. Also includes a letter written to the Public Service Board on behalf of Tony Dalton requesting a more detailed explanation as to why he was dismissed from the State Rivers & Water Supply Commission, an article from the Age featuring an interview with Gough Whitlam and Lance Barnard relating to proposed government action to abolish conscription and release jailed draft resisters and a copy of William McMahon's written statement outling the government's position of items of concern to Commonwealth employees requested by the Federal Secretary of the Council of Commonwealth Public Service Organisations.

Political Ephemera Relating to Conscription
Author:
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 0
Book Description
Predominantly consists of news clippings detailing the growing opposition to conscription and ongoing parliamentary debate about the National Service Act. Contains a report of the Anti-War Activists Conference from 1967 and a short statement on conscription undersigned by prominent Australian writers. Also includes various articles from periodicals and publications by Students for a Democratic Society (SDS) and the Draft Resisters' Union.
